About Loyola University Maryland – Sellinger School of Business and Management
Loyola’s Sellinger School of Business and Management provides academically challenging management education inspired by Jesuit traditions and values. The school maintains three campuses in the greater Baltimore metropolitan area and is the only private institution in the state of Maryland that earned accreditation by AACSB in all programs. 

Busch Chair in Strategic Management  (Tenure Track)

Position duties

We are seeking a distinguished professor who is capable of interacting with the business and management community and who can administer and conduct theoretical and applied research in management.
The candidate is required to teach an advanced seminar in his or her area of expertise, organize a conference as a forum for the business and academic community and continue an excellent research and publication stream in scholarly journals. 
The candidate must be able to teach courses in the undergraduate, graduate and Executive MBA programs offered by Loyola University Maryland. The teaching load is 2 courses per semester, with 2-3 preps, with research and service to the department, school, and university. Candidates must maintain a strong research agenda with demonstrated publication in peer-reviewed and high profile journals.

Required qualifications

Have an earned doctorate from an AACSB accredited institution (or equivalent).
Demonstrate a strong, active record as a teacher, with accomplishments commensurate with the rank of associate or full professor. Show flexibility as a teacher, e.g., the ability and willingness to teach a wide range of courses in undergraduate and graduate programs.
Distinguished record of scholarship as demonstrated by peer-reviewed publications in highly selective journals within the discipline. The candidate should have the ability to provide research leadership within the department.
